WebThe Land Registry was created as a result of the Land Adjudication process, a UK Government-sponsored initiative during the 1970s. The process replaced the registration of deeds (whereby the papers associated with land transactions were registered) with a registration of title system - whereby the land itself was registered. WebApr 10, 2024 · The land registry is a government agency that maintains a database of all registered properties in England and Wales. The land registry provides several online services that allow users to search for property ownership information. These services include the property register, title plan, and title summary. ...
